Beetroot is another delicious, nutritious, and versatile vegetable, easy to grow. Growing beetroot is ideal for beginners and is well suited to large or small home gardens since it takes up little space. Both the roots and the leaves of beetroots are excellent sources of antioxidants, minerals, and vitamin C. you can eat them raw, cooked, and pickled.


STEP 1

Select a sunny location where receive at least six hours of direct sunshine. The soil should be well-draining, loose, rich in organic matter, and slightly acidic to neutral in pH.



STEP 2

Dig some well-rotted manure and general-purpose fertilizer into the soil and remove any large stones before sowing, creating ridges 4 to 6 inches tall. In the spring, sow beet seeds in the garden 2 to 3 weeks before the last average frost date. Make a 12-inch deep furrow in the center of the ridge with a hoe

handle.


STEP 3

Seeds should be spaced 1 to 2 inches apart in rows about 1 foot apart.


STEP 4

Then Sprinkle seeds with water after lightly covering them with loose dirt. Cover seed with sand or light-colored mulch in hot weather.


STEP 5

When seedlings reach 2.5cm (1in), thin them out so there's only one seedling in a 10cm radius.



STEP 6

Keep the area weed-free and avoid over-watering.


STEP 7

Beets will be ready to harvest 7 to 8 weeks after sowing. Harvest roots when golf-ball-size or larger; 2.5 cm (1 in) in diameter and are most tender before they exceed 7.5–10 cm (3–4 in); very large roots may be tough and fibrous. Pull the beet out of the ground by loosening the soil surrounding it. Harvest the beet greens at almost any time, beginning when thinning seedlings. Take one or two mature leaves per plant, until leaf blades are more than 6 inches tall and become tough.
